Rio Tinto reopens train line after derailment

Global miner Rio Tinto has reopened its train line near Dampier in the Pilbara, Western Australia, following a derailment over the weekend, Kallanish notes. The first train travelled on the restored line on Tuesday night. "Safety is our top priority and the recovery and clean-up work at the site is progressing at a safe distance from the rail line and nearby power and water infrastructure," Rio Tinto says.
